Managed Pressure Drilling (MPD): A Paradigm Shift
MPD drilling represents a paradigm shift in the drilling industry. Unlike conventional methods that rely on constant bottom hole pressure, MPD provides a dynamic approach to wellbore pressure management. By adjusting surface backpressure, drilling fluid density, and mud pump rates in real-time, MPD allows for more precise control over downhole pressures.
Pros of MPD Drilling:
1. Enhanced Safety:
One of the primary advantages of MPD drilling is improved safety. The dynamic pressure management minimizes the risk of kicks and blowouts, enhancing well control during the drilling process.
2. Optimized ROP (Rate of Penetration):
MPD facilitates better control over wellbore pressure, leading to improved drilling efficiency and, consequently, higher rates of penetration. This can result in significant time and cost savings.
3. Mitigation of Drilling Challenges:
MPD is particularly effective in challenging drilling environments, such as those with narrow drilling margins or unstable formations. The ability to adjust parameters in real-time helps mitigate drilling challenges.
Cons of MPD Drilling:
1. Complexity and Cost:
Implementing MPD requires specialized equipment and trained personnel, leading to higher upfront costs. The complexity of the system also demands a learning curve for drilling crews.
2. Limited Applicability:
While MPD is highly effective in certain drilling scenarios, it may not be the optimal choice for every project. Its applicability depends on factors such as well depth, formation characteristics, and drilling objectives.
Conventional Drilling: Time-Tested and Reliable
Conventional drilling methods have been the cornerstone of the oil and gas industry for decades. The process involves maintaining a constant bottom hole pressure by adjusting mud weight and pump rates, providing a stable environment for drilling.
Pros of Conventional Drilling:
1. Familiarity and Experience:
Conventional drilling methods are well-established, and drilling crews are generally more familiar with their implementation. This can lead to smoother operations and quicker project timelines.
2. Lower Implementation Cost:
Unlike MPD, conventional drilling requires less specialized equipment and training. This translates to lower implementation costs for drilling projects.
Cons of Conventional Drilling:
1. Risk of Well Control Issues:
The constant bottom hole pressure approach in conventional drilling carries a higher risk of well control issues, including kicks and blowouts. This risk necessitates vigilant monitoring and quick responses.
2. Limited Precision:
Conventional drilling lacks the precision in pressure management that MPD offers. This limitation can result in challenges when dealing with narrow drilling margins or complex geological formations.
Striking the Right Balance
In the drilling fluid industry, the choice between MPD and conventional drilling is not a one-size-fits-all decision. Project-specific considerations, geological factors, and safety requirements all play crucial roles in determining the most suitable approach.
As technology continues to advance, the drilling industry is witnessing a trend towards integrating aspects of both methods. Some projects may benefit from the stability of conventional drilling in certain sections, coupled with the precision control offered by MPD drilling in others.
